45 minutes ago45 min Author 15 minutes ago, LeanMeanGM said:No. There is no protection anymore.2 minutes ago, BigEFly said:Not protected, just means the IPP spot, which doesn’t count against the 16 player PS limit.What am I misunderstanding?At the end of training camp, IPP players can either be signed to their assigned club’s 53-man roster or waived. Players who clear waivers may be signed to their assigned team’s practice squad using an IPP exemption that allows for an extra practice squad spot. IPP players signed to a practice squad using the exemption may not be signed to any team’s active roster that season; however, players signed to a practice squad without the exemption are treated in the same way as other practice squad players for roster purposes.https://operations.nfl.com/programs-initiatives/international-growth/international-player-pathway
